Vtex Ratios

Ratios Dec2019 Dec2020 Dec2021 Dec2022 Dec2023 Dec2024
Profitability
Gross Margin 66.99%64.68%60.57%66.48%69.75%73.79%
EBT Margin -6.02%3.51%-55.64%-35.81%-5.25%4.26%
EBIT Margin -2.95%6.61%-52.42%-31.67%-7.25%4.46%
EBITDA Margin -2.95%-0.15%-47.68%-31.67%-7.25%4.46%
Operating Margin -2.95%6.61%-52.42%-31.67%-7.25%4.46%
Net Margin -7.49%-0.93%-48.11%-33.26%-6.79%5.29%
FCF Margin 1.30%11.61%-43.23%-18.76%1.88%11.96%
Efficiency
Assets Average 353.96M
Equity Average 201.41M300.93M257.50M248.07M
Invested Capital 11.03M81.98M330.47M275.83M240.33M255.80M
Asset Utilization Ratio 0.64
Leverage & Solvency
Interest Coverage Ratio -0.570.93-5.47-1.59-0.340.30
Debt to Equity 0.080.010.00
Debt Ratio 0.01
Equity Ratio 0.790.700.70
Times Interest Earned -0.570.93-5.47-1.59-0.340.30
Dividends & Payouts
FCF Payout Ratio 1.71
Valuation
Enterprise Value -29.76M-75.53M1,745.78M480.49M1,067.11M877.93M
Market Capitalization 2,043.97M719.03M1,276.48M1,092.74M
Return Ratios
Return on Sales -0.07%-0.01%-0.48%-0.33%-0.07%0.05%
Return on Capital Employed 0.04%
Return on Invested Capital -0.28%-0.15%
Return on Assets 0.03%
Return on Equity -0.30%-0.17%-0.05%0.05%